Im new to Navision and having problems with the item table. it seems that the Product Line field for each item has changed and is displaying the wrong data...im trying to figure out how this happened and am stumped. The only thing i can think of is that when we added a new product line to the product line list...the existing product line entries for items got mixed up. Does this make sense and could it have happened? If this is the problem can someone tell me how to add a new line to the Product Line list without causing this to happen again? We have been adding new product lines by going into the properties of the Product Line text box and typing the new product line at the end of the OptionString...is this wrong??

A handy tip for people who make option trings which could be expaned in the future. Creat some empty options in between. Sample:
Type - Option - Customer,,,,Vendor,,,,Contact,,,,Item,,,,Ect.
The empty options will not show in the option list.

If you would add options ONLY at the end, nothing should go wrong. Sample:
Sales Header - Document Type - option - Quote,Order,Invoice,Credit Memo,Blanket Order,Return Order
The sales line has the same option. If I would add a option to the "Document Type" in the header this would translate in the lines as a number.
Never the less, you should always keep the option strings the same.
